WebOct 5, 2009 · Boiling water alone is sufficient to sanitize your camping cookware if a scrubbing would scratch non-stick surfaces. Well-seasoned cast iron cookware has a non-stick surface that you can just wipe clean. If scrubbing is necessary, use coarse salt. It scours away food that's stuck on and adds seasoning to the next meal.

Heat Source Control Add Water to the Unit The Significance of Coffee Branding The Material Design of Coffee Percolator … scam calls from allstate insuranceWebFeb 11, 2024 · Coffee will steep unless your cup is rather tall Requires hot water separately Similar to the GSI Outdoors Ultralight Java Drip, the Primula Coffee Brew Buddy is constructed of a single piece... scam calls from moldovaWebJan 24, 2024 · Camp cooks made coffee in three-to-five-gallon cowboy coffee pots to make sure there was always a steady supply of cowboy coffee. A pot of steaming strong black cowboy coffee over an open campfire was a standard fixture in camp. Cowboys rode for hours and worked hard, and they needed coffee before and after long shifts. scam calls from amazon primeWebJun 1, 2024 · The coffee pot usually has a hole in the bottom which allows you to place a utensil such as a spoon or a fork inside.
